CmdRankPlus is a Spigot/Paper Minecraft plugin that executes custom commands based on permissions and ranks defined in a configuration file. This plugin is designed to be flexible and easy to configure.

📂 Installation
1. Download the plugin JAR file from the Releases section. 2. Place the file in your Minecraft server's `plugins` folder. 3. Restart your server to generate the `config.yml` file. 4. Configure commands and ranks in the `config.yml` file.
***
⚙️ Configuration (`config.yml`)
Here's an example configuration:
```yaml commands: shops: rang1: "/shop {player} shop1" rang2: "/shop {player} shop2" rang3: "/shop {player} shop3" menu: rang1: "/menu {player} menu1" rang2: "/menu {player} menu2" rang3: "/menu {player} menu3" ```
Explanations:
- `rangX`: List of trigger commands (e.g., `/shops`, `/menu`). - `rangX`: Specific actions associated with each rank. - `{player}`: Corresponds to the player's username. - `{rank}`: Corresponds to the rank name.

🛠️ Commands
Main Commands:
| Command | Description | |------------------------|-----------------------------------------------------------------------------| | `/cmdrankplus reload` | Reloads the configuration (ranks and associated actions). | | `/cmdrankplus help` | Displays a detailed guide on how the plugin works. |
Notes:
- ⚠ Reloading trigger commands: To add new commands like `/shops`, you must restart the Minecraft server.
***
🔑 Permissions
Main Permissions:
| Permission | Description | |------------------------|-----------------------------------------------------------------------------| | `cmdrankplus.reload` | Allows execution of the `/cmdrankplus reload` command. Default for OPs. |
Rank-based permission management:
To associate a user with a rank, add a permission like `cmdrankplus.rangX` via LuckPerms or another permission manager.
Example with LuckPerms: ```bash /lp group <group_name> permission set cmdrankplus.rang1 true ```
***
📝 Usage Examples
1. A player with the `cmdrankplus.rang1` permission executes `/shops`. - The plugin executes the command configured for `rang1`, for example `/shop <player> shop1`.
2. An administrator wants to reload the configuration after modification: - They execute `/cmdrankplus reload`.
***
🛑 Limitations
- New trigger commands (e.g., `/shops`) require a server restart to be detected. - Permissions must be defined in `config.yml` before being used with LuckPerms for auto-completion.
